Bias Analysis
Detected Bias Types
windows_first
powershell_heavy
Summary
The documentation provides both Azure CLI and Azure PowerShell examples for verifying results, but the PowerShell examples are given equal prominence and detail as the CLI examples. PowerShell is primarily a Windows tool, and its inclusion alongside CLI may suggest a slight Windows bias, especially since no explicit Linux shell examples (e.g., bash, sh) are provided. The variable assignment syntax in the PowerShell tab uses `$resource_group_name=$(terraform output -raw resource_group_name)`, which is not standard PowerShell and may confuse Linux users. There are no Linux-specific instructions or troubleshooting tips, and no mention of platform differences in running Terraform or Azure CLI/PowerShell.
Recommendations
- Add explicit bash/Linux shell examples for all CLI commands, especially for variable assignment and command usage.
- Clarify any platform-specific differences in running Terraform, Azure CLI, and PowerShell (e.g., installation, environment setup).
- If PowerShell is included, note that it is available cross-platform, but provide guidance for Linux/macOS users on using bash/zsh.
- Ensure troubleshooting and cleanup sections mention both Windows and Linux environments where relevant.
- Consider listing Azure CLI (which is cross-platform) before PowerShell, or provide a clear note about platform compatibility.
Create Pull Request